3" Shop-vac hose, connected to the air cleaner housing with a rubber pipe connector & hose clamps. I even used a shop vac attachment for the air horn. Here's a pic. Less than $20 as I recall. HTH

You got a Home Desperate or Lowes in your area, or something similar? Go to the plumbing dept. The rubber fitting with hose clamps on each end that connects the stock air snorkle to the vac hose is a repair coupler for drain/waste pipe. They can be found in many different diameters.
